Cost of repairing an uPVC door

Although fixing an uPVC door may seem costly but there are ways to save money. You can repair it yourself if your issue is not too significant. In some cases, repairing doors can be as easy as replacing a broken handle. However, in some cases, the door may be damaged beyond repair, and this will require an entire replacement. You might want to replace the entire door, if the damage is severe. This will be more expensive.

Broken gearboxes can cause problems in the ability to lock or unlock uPVC doors. In such a case you'll need to replace the gearbox, which could cost as much as PS260. Broken gearboxes could also mean that the door is not operational. To avoid this it is possible to repair the gearbox by yourself, or employ a locksmith to unlock the door. Misaligned hinges are another common problem with uPVC doors. Older hinges could be misaligned and require professional help. The locksmith can repair hinges that are not aligned or adjust them if damaged. In more severe cases the door could require replacement. If hinges are damaged, the entire uPVC door could need to be replaced. You may be able to repair it by an expert if you do not have the funds.

Adjusting the hinges and latches can fix damaged uPVC door. A damaged gearbox could cost upwards of 600 dollars. Some companies offer the service of installing an entirely new door. There are a variety of locks available for uPVC doors. SmartLocks can be used with a keycard or an app on your phone or a combination of both. To protect your home, a uPVC door should also be secured with locks that are anti-snap. This is required by Secured by Design standards, and will stand up to a 15-minute forced entry attempt. The process of fitting a uPVC door isn't simple, so a specialist supplier is recommended.

Floppy handles are also an issue with uPVC doors. If your door's handle has become floppy, a locksmith will be able to fix it with the least damage. They will take apart all the parts that are working and replace the main centre unit or complete uPVC door locking strip. They will also adjust the door to ensure that the handle isn't loose. Sometimes the handle of a door may require replacing.

Acrylic compound can be used in the event that you recognize the problem. Be sure to apply the compound within two minutes of mixing it or otherwise it will become difficult to work with and might not blend into the UPVC properly. Spread the compound with a putty knife and finish by sanding it using 240 and 600 gritty. To make the door look beautiful, apply a transparent coat to its entire surface.
